What Is the Facebook Ads Manager
Ads Manager is a dashboard within Business Manager where you can view, edit, and access performance reports for all your campaigns, ad sets, and ads. What Is the Facebook Audience Network?
The Audience Network, a partnership between Facebook and several app owners, allows you to reach more people on different mobile apps. What Is Facebook Relevance Score?
Relevance Score is a metric that estimates your ad's relevance to its target audience in real time. The more relevant an ad is to your audience, the better it’s likely to perform.
